Stainless steel hygienic reducers are essential components that connect pipes of different diameters within piping systems and ensure the smooth movement of fluids. These components play a critical role in routing pipelines and controlling pressure.

Hygienic Reducer Products
There are two main types of reducers: eccentric reducers and concentric reducers. Eccentric reducers are used to support piping connections and minimize noise and vibration that may occur during flow.
With this type of reducer, one side may be flatter or more curved than the other, allowing the fluid to move more smoothly and quietly. It also helps prevent air from accumulating in the pipeline and reduces turbulence in the fluid.
Concentric reducers have a more symmetrical construction and resemble a conical shape. They narrow evenly from the larger diameter to the smaller diameter on both sides. These reducers are used to decrease or increase pressure within the pipeline.

Applications of Hygienic Reducers
Stainless steel reducer products are generally used in the food industry and in facilities where hygienic requirements are a priority. These components are preferred in permanent installations where process pipes do not need to be dismantled for cleaning.
Stainless steel stands out for its ability to meet hygienic standards and for its durability, making it a reliable choice for the food industry.
Hygienic reducers play an important role in transferring products from storage areas and liquid-transport tankers. Stainless steel reducers direct the fluid correctly and safely, helping minimize product loss and the risk of contamination.
